What to check before for buildings with low open violation rates near Spring St station in NYC

  • Use the low-open-violations filter as a screening step, then confirm specifics directly with the superintendent or management at the time of inquiry.
  • Cross-check the building’s current status (superintendent contact, maintenance response, and any recent complaint patterns) because open-records can lag real-world conditions.
  • Ask for proof of pest-control and remediation steps if any prior issues affected your unit type, not just the building overall.
  • Before signing, review move-in costs (deposit, broker fee if applicable, and required documentation) and align them with your timeline for repairs.
  • When touring near transit, confirm noise, elevator availability, and any building access rules that could affect daily schedules.
